Responsibilities:
- Prepare and serve alcoholic and non-alcoholic beverages to customers
- Take customer orders and provide recommendations based on their preferences
- Maintain a clean and organized bar area
- Check identification of customers to verify age requirements for alcohol consumption
- Handle cash transactions and operate the cash register accurately
- Provide excellent customer service and address any customer concerns or complaints
- Monitor alcohol consumption and ensure responsible drinking practices
- Collaborate with kitchen staff to coordinate food and beverage orders for customers
- Assist with banquet or catering events as needed
Experience:
- Previous experience (at least three years) in food service or hospitality industry preferred
- Knowledge of brewing techniques and different types of alcoholic beverages
- Familiarity with retail math for cash handling and inventory management
- Ability to handle multiple tasks in a fast-paced environment
- Strong communication and interpersonal skills
- Ability to work well in a team and collaborate with other staff members
